Matt2107
12-03-07, 10:24 AM
The vinyl traps water between the vinyl and the metal... therefore it is a prime place to rust.
Most Nova's rust from the inside out on the doors so once the surface of the paint breaks its bye bye doors. On my old SR one door was full of filler from a previous owner and the other was bascially held together by the vinyl.
